【问题标题】:Visual Studio 2015 different version number causes solution file to be checked outVisual Studio 2015 不同版本号导致解决方案文件被签出
【发布时间】:2016-05-18 09:11:30
【问题描述】:

我不确定这是通用问题还是我们的项目特定问题。我们有 mvc 应用程序,前几天我意识到每次打开解决方案 VS 2015 更新 2 时都会检查解决方案。当我比较差异/变化时,我看到它是 Visual Studio 版本,如下图所示。

这是因为我同事的版本号较低。但是我想知道为什么VS在版本号不同时会检查解决方案?当我用 VS 2013 打开同一个项目时,它甚至不会发生。

TFS 版本是在 TFSVC 上运行的 2012。

【问题讨论】:

    标签: visual-studio visual-studio-2015 solution


    【解决方案1】:

    当您使用其他版本打开解决方案时,它会相应地更新版本。这是为了确保如果功能不向后兼容,其他用户会在尝试使用旧版本打开时收到警告。

    当您更新 SSDT 时,数据库项目也会发生这种情况。

    由于您运行的是相同的主要版本,因此即使您签入更改也不应该成为问题。

    【讨论】:

    • 旧版本是指具有旧版本号的相同版本还是类似于 2013-2015 的版本,因为在 2013-2015 之间我无法重现这种情况,仅发生在与 2015 相同但版本号不同的版本中。
    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2015-10-13
    • 2015-10-10
    • 1970-01-01
    • 2015-10-25
    相关资源
    最近更新 更多